Ignoring a cracked windshield really does jeopardize you and your passengers’ safety. A vehicle’s windshield accounts for at least 45% of the structural support in a front-end collision and 60% in a rollover accident. These days, a windshield is more than a pane of glass. Technological advances include humidity and rain sensors, radio antennas and temperature gauges mounted within the layers of a windshield's safety glass. These complex instruments make do-it-yourself auto glass repair tricky if not impossible. Auto Glass Replacement

If broken, tempered safety glass breaks into small chunks and doesn’t fly apart as harmful, jagged shards that put you and your passengers at risk. Because this type of glass is designed to shatter safely in an accident, repair usually isn’t an option. Tempered glass is commonly used for:

  • Back Passenger windows
  • Rear window
  • Side window quarter glass
  • Sunroof
